John Penta writes: On Thu, 18 Sep 2003 00:03:05 -0400, (Peter Stickney) wrote: I gave up & went with Brassey's instead. Much more information, and much less pretence. Yes, but what's the price for Brassey's like in the US? Let'me check ... The Year 2000 edition listed for about $80.00 US, less 20% for buying it form a distributer. The technical information is much more comprehensive than _Jane's_, and covers a much wider timeframe. (In other words, it has accurate information on older stuff still in service.) When you compare it to the new "streamlined" versions of _Jame's_, going at more than $150.00 US a pop, I know where I'd rather put my money. -- Pete Stickney A strong conviction that something must be done is the parent of many bad measures. -- Daniel Webster |
